Large cell neuroendocrine carcinoma (LCNEC) is a high-grade malignant neuroendocrine tumor that was first defined in the lungs. There are six previous reports on LCNEC in the gallbladder, comprising three cases combined with another tumor and three pure LCNECs. We describe a tumor combined with LCNEC and adenocarcinoma elements arising in the gallbladder and give a review of the literature. A 68-year-old woman was diagnosed as having gallbladder wall thickening and a hepatic mass. The surgically resected tumor had a dumbbell shape with gallbladder and liver elements. Histological examination revealed LCNEC in the liver and a deep infiltrative portion of the gallbladder, as well as a well-differentiated tubular adenocarcinoma in the mucosa of the gallbladder. The pseudoglandular structures of LCNEC were marked in the transitional area. Immunoreactivities for carcinoembryonic antigen and CA19-9 as well as for chromogranin A and synaptophysin were detected in the LCNEC element. High p53-protein expression and high proliferative activity estimated by Ki-67 positivity were observed in both elements. The results suggest a close relationship between LCNEC and adenocarcinoma, and support the theory that these elements originate from common cancer stem cells. (C) 2009 Elsevier GmbH.
